Output d66570710cb32df42be2295f13b107320ba8680a4111243448955f0422888f77:1

value
4649229
script pubkey
OP_0 OP_PUSHBYTES_32 1a6c3df8ffd82b5d657e69b7b61bebc01e4dce5ec2bbf98e26a14ba104f1cfbe
address
bc1qrfkrm78lmq446et7dxmmvxltcq0ymnj7c2alnr3x5996zp83e7lqnxlfmv
transaction
d66570710cb32df42be2295f13b107320ba8680a4111243448955f0422888f77